Just like to ask about bolting up seats after putting in new carpet in my ute. some time ago i lost the tips off a couple of fingers and cant feel and hold on to the bolts properly. what im asking is. if i put the bolts from the bottom up and push the carpet over it and place the seats over the studs and tighten them with nuts. would that be strong enough to hold the seats in place.

I thought the bolts sticking up would foul the seat sliders. How about using cap screws (5/16 grade 5 or 8) so that you can put the bolt onto an allen key and push it into place from inside the cab, then put the nut on under the floor pan.
